Q. Which are nucleotides "portions" that to bind in the formation of nucleic acids? What is meant by the 5' and 3' extremities of the nucleic acids?
The phosphate group of one nucleotide binds to the pentose of the other nucleotide and so on to make the polynucleotide chain.
Each extremity of a RNA or DNA chain can be distinguished from the other extremity according to their terminal chemical entity. The phosphate-ended extremity is known as 5'-extremity and the pentose-ended extremity is called 3'-extremity. So RNA or DNA chains can be run along the 3'-5' way or along the 5'-3' way. These ways are significant in several biological functions of RNA and DNA since some reactions specifically occur following one way or the other way.
